Apple has confirmed its much talked about September event.

As was expected, the event is music/iPod themed. While this will undoubtedly mean iPods with cameras and a look at iTunes 9, Steve Jobs' appearance has been rumored for the event as well as an Apple tablet.

TechCrunch reports that Apple will shift focus to the iPod Touch as the main iPod. Anyone have any predictions about what Apple will offer this year? Let us know in the comments below!
